WIRED has published its updated 2026 buying guide to the best air purifiers, drawing on hands-on testing across a range of budgets, room sizes and pollutant types. The reviewer, who has lived through severe wildfire smoke in California and now contends with pet dander, gas-stove fumes and urban pollution in New York, frames air purifiers as a long-term household investment worth researching carefully rather than a disposable appliance.

Top recommendations include the premium IQAir Atem X (£1,400/$1,400) as the overall best performer, praised for its quiet operation, app control and optional 10-year warranty, though it lacks a carbon filter for gases. Budget-conscious buyers are pointed to the Coway Airmega Mighty2 ($270), while the Coway Airmega 450 ($499) is singled out for tackling odours and the Levoit Vital 200S-P ($190) for homes with pets. For wildfire smoke specifically, the guide recommends the Rabbit Air BioGS 2.0 ($375). The July 2026 update added the Shark BreatheClear Max and IQAir Healthpro Plus, alongside refreshed testing details and pricing.
